A vlog by the YouTube channel named in the video’s upper left corner and serves as the original blog post for this content.Chef Cliff Rome, a legend of the Chicago food scene, sits down with “CBS Saturday Morning” to discuss his contract with the Obama Presidential Center, which opened to the public on Juneteenth. “CBS Saturday Morning” delivers two hours of original reporting and breaking news, as well as profiles of leading figures in culture and the arts.
